> I recently completed a total gearbox and overdrive tear down, parts 
> inspection and replacement as necessary, and reassembly.  After the 
> system was back in the car and had 600-700 miles on it I needed to 
> correct a major leak that had developed.  As a result of this second 
> effort I found nearly all of the nuts and bolts on the system casework 
> required re-tightening.  Having never before having tackled a project 
> like a transmission overhaul I was surprised to find the fasteners had 
> apparently loosened.  I had very carefully wrenched them all during 
> the reassembly process with the objective of making sure all nuts/lock 
> washers and bolts were as tight as they had been on disassembly.   Yet 
> they all took one to two flats of re-tightening during the leak 
> search.  Is this need to re-tighten transmission hardware at all 
> common?  Oh yeah, leak found and fixed.
